Presentation

Rebecca was born on February 1, 1969 in Aix en Provence.

She is the daughter of the writer Françoise Lefèvre and the painter Raya Sorkine.

When her parents separated Rebecca was barely a year old.

His mother raises him alone, with his older sister Olivia.

Rebecca grew up in Paris, Rue vielle du Temple (3eme arrd), Rue Leriche and Rue Lacretelle (15eme arrd), before moving to the Essonne department in Auvers-Saint-Georges, then in 1978 in Burgundy near Dijon.

At 16, Rebecca took the entrance exam to the conservatory of dramatic art in Dijon to become an actress, she stayed there for two years and at the same time followed theater classes at the Parvis Saint-Jean. But Rebecca is not at ease in this discipline, she leaves the conservatory and returns to the Beaux-Arts of Beaune where she hopes to blossom in her true passion, painting. It's a disappointment, the teachers don't encourage her, she won't graduate.

She decides to focus on qualifying training provided by craftsmen, and will pass a competition for a painting-wood sculpture ornamentation training in Beaune that she will obtain. She will learn traditional techniques such as tempera painting, wax painting. Then two years will follow or she will resume drawing on a living model as a free candidate for the fine arts of Dijon.

In 1992 she discovers mosaic, the materials and the technique will seduce her, she is captivated by the colors of the glass enamels, it will be her favorite material. For twenty years she will compose all kinds of decorations working in collaboration with tiling shops in Paris, architects and interior designers who will present her unique creations to their clients.

In 1999 she obtained the honorary vocation prize from the Fondation de France for her mosaic creations, which enabled her to continue her original research.

In 2005 Rebecca decides to take over the brushes, her painting is then figurative.

In 2010 she left Burgundy to settle in Marseille.

The South will bring her new inspirations, she experiments with different pictorial universes such as cubism.

Passage to abstraction

His overflowing curiosity for matter and colors, his need to go beyond his limits, and his ability to question himself will gradually orient him towards lyrical abstract expressionism.

This passage towards abstraction will fulfill all her expectations, she feels liberated.

Rebecca, who is a born colorist, is going to have a lot of fun.

It is a meeting in 2020 with the one who will become his agent Arry Bennatia who will encourage him to assert himself in this direction.

Lyrical abstraction is movement, body language and the energy of the moment thanks to which we can create.

"Energy is the engine"

Rebecca constructs her paintings intuitively, her emotions are expressed directly on the canvas in a spontaneous way by pouring the paint or by projecting it. We give the term "Dripping" These canvases are made in both vertical and horizontal positions. Rebecca realizes her paintings on free canvas in order to keep total freedom in movement.
